=head1 DESCRIPTION
This creates REST controllers according to the specifications at
L<Catalyst::Controller::DBIC::API> and L<Catalyst::Controller::DBIC::API::REST>
for all the classes in your Catalyst app.
It creates the following files:
MyApp/lib/MyApp/Controller/API.pm
MyApp/lib/MyApp/Controller/API/REST.pm
MyApp/lib/MyApp/Controller/API/REST/*
MyApp/lib/MyApp/ControllerBase/REST.pm
Individual class controllers are under MyApp/lib/MyApp/Controller/API/REST/*.
=head2 CONFIGURATION
The idea is to make configuration as painless and as automatic as possible, so most
of the work has been done for you.
There are 8 __PACKAGE__->config(...) options for L<Catalyst::Controller::DBIC::API/CONFIGURATION>.
Here are the defaults.
=head2 create_requires
All non-nullable columns that are (1) not autoincrementing,
(2) don't have a default value, are neither (3) nextvals,
(4) sequences, nor (5) timestamps.
=head2 create_allows
All nullable columns that are (1) not autoincrementing,
(2) don't have a default value, are neither (3) nextvals,
(4) sequences, nor (5) timestamps.
=head2 update_allows
The union of create_requires and create_allows.
=head2 list_returns
Every column in the class.
=head2 list_prefetch
Nothing is prefetched by default.
=head2 list_prefetch_allows
(1) An arrayref consisting of the name of each of the class's
has_many relationships, accompanied by (2) a hashref keyed on
the name of that relationship, whose values are the names of
its has_many's, e.g., in the "Producer" controller above, a
Producer has many cd_to_producers, many tags, and many tracks.
None of those classes have any has_many's:
list_prefetch_allows => [
[qw/cd_to_producer/], { 'cd_to_producer' => [qw//] },
[qw/tags/], { 'tags' => [qw//] },
[qw/tracks/], { 'tracks' => [qw//] },
],
=head2 list_ordered_by
The primary key.
=head2 list_search_exposes
(1) An arrayref consisting of the name of each column in the class,
and (2) a hashref keyed on the name of each of the class's has many
relationships, the values of which are all the columns in the
corresponding class, e.g.,
list_search_exposes => [
qw/cdid artist title year/,
{ 'cd_to_producer' => [qw/cd producer/] },
{ 'tags' => [qw/tagid cd tag/] },
{ 'tracks' => [qw/trackid cd position title last_updated_on/] },
], # columns that can be searched on via list
=head1 CONTROLLERBASE
Following the advice in L<Catalyst::Controller::DBIC::API/EXTENDING>, this
module creates an intermediate class between your controllers and
L<Catalyst::Controller::DBIC::API::REST>. It contains one method, create,
which serializes object information and stores it in the stash, which is
not the default behavior.
=head1 METHODS
=head2 mk_compclass
This is the meat of the helper. It writes the directory structure if it is
not in place, API.pm, REST.pm, the controllerbase, and the result class
controllers. It replaces $helper->{} values as it goes through, rendering
the files for each.
